Two hosts tackle practical finance and investing topics with a focus on tax efficiency, financial planning, and lifelong wealth-building. Episodes cover how AI and macro shifts could affect markets and ownership, tax-efficient asset location, cash-flow systems, and different investment approaches, always framed around actionable decisions for high-wealth individuals, business owners, and families. The conversations blend real-world case studies, concrete planning steps, and myth-busting insights, emphasizing disciplined spending, debt management, and long-horizon strategies over short-term gains.
